Vision-Language-Action Models

Companies developing vision-language models that are extended with action heads or policies to directly control physical robots and autonomous systems.

Gemini Robotics 2 resets the frontier VLA benchmark

Google DeepMind's Gemini Robotics 2 (signal [1]) and the concurrent release of Gemini 3.1 Pro (signal [41]) mark a step-change in foundation-model-to-robot-policy transfer, with AGI countdown sites revising probability upward to 98% on its announcement (signal [4]). Gemini 3.1 Flash already leads competing VLM architectures on seed-point prediction at 71.87% average success versus Qwen 3.5 Flash at 54.42% and GPT 5.4 at 42.61% (signal [21]), establishing Google DeepMind as the performance leader for real-world manipulation tasks. The release validates the thesis that large vision-language backbones can be adapted end-to-end into robot controllers—a design principle Google DeepMind has championed—and sets a new competitive baseline that every other VLA lab must now respond to.

▲ STRENGTHENINGPhysical Intelligence's π0.5 becomes the canonical open research substrate

π0.5 was formally published as an arXiv product release (signal [34]), with research confirming that representations from its pretrained backbone enable rapid improvement throughout training (signal [31]), and it is now used as the basis for derivative architectures like XS-VLA's action-generation approach (signal [43]). Temporal GRPO methods are already being benchmarked against π0, with Temporal GRPO scoring 75.8% versus π0's 49.2% on RoboTwin 2.0 (signal [3]), signaling that the open research community is actively building on and surpassing it. Physical Intelligence's dual role as both a product company and a research platform provider mirrors Hugging Face's dynamic in language AI.

Why it matters · A widely adopted open backbone accelerates the entire ecosystem but compresses the window for Physical Intelligence to monetize proprietary performance advantages.

▲ STRENGTHENINGNVIDIA consolidates VLA infrastructure across capital, compute, and models

NVIDIA appears as a co-investor in multiple large rounds—including a $2B growth round (signal [14]) and a separate $1.1B round alongside AMD Ventures (signal [7]) and another $1.1B round with General Catalyst, YC, and Temasek (signal [24])—while simultaneously open-sourcing Cosmos (including training frameworks, synthetic data, and model weights, signal [17]) and releasing Cosmos 3, an omni-modal World Foundation Model combining video, audio, language, and action signals (signal [19]). NVIDIA's GR00T N1 is cited as the baseline generalist robot foundation model, and Temporal GRPO post-training methods are explicitly described as applicable to GR00T (signal [11]). Hardware benchmarking across the arXiv Physical AI corpus uniformly relies on NVIDIA silicon—RTX PRO 6000, Jetson Thor, RTX 3090/4090/5090 (signal [9])—cementing compute lock-in alongside the software stack.

Why it matters · NVIDIA is positioning to capture value at every layer of the VLA stack—silicon, simulation, foundation models, and venture capital—making it the unavoidable platform for the physical AI era.

▲ NEWEfficient small VLAs challenge the scale-only orthodoxy

SmolVLA (signal [44]) and SmolVLM2-0.25B (signal [42])—both sub-3B parameter architectures—demonstrate that capable VLA policies can be distilled into models small enough for edge deployment, directly contesting the industry assumption that scaling alone yields deployable robots (signal [45]). XCoT-VLA introduces executable chain-of-thought reasoning for autonomous driving VLAs (signal [39]), while research explicitly flags that verbose natural-language CoT is poorly suited to real-time control due to decoding cost and optimization difficulty (signal [40]). These architectural innovations point toward a bifurcated market: massive frontier VLAs for training and a new tier of compact, deployment-ready action models.

Why it matters · Operators and OEMs deploying robots at scale will favor efficient edge-deployable VLAs, opening a new product category distinct from frontier research models.
